Overview
Serving 700 students in grades Kindergarten-5, Mccordsville Elementary School ranks in the top 20% of all schools in Indiana for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 20%, and reading proficiency is top 20%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 63% (which is higher than the Indiana state average of 39%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 50% (which is higher than the Indiana state average of 41%).
The student-teacher ratio of 15:1 is equal to the Indiana state level of 15:1.
Minority enrollment is 31% of the student body (majority Black), which is lower than the Indiana state average of 38% (majority Hispanic and Black).
Serving 800 students in grades 1-6, Amy Beverland Elementary School ranks in the top 50% of all schools in Indiana for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is top 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 47% (which is higher than the Indiana state average of 39%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 48% (which is higher than the Indiana state average of 41%).
The student-teacher ratio of 21:1 is higher than the Indiana state level of 15:1.
Minority enrollment is 64% of the student body (majority Black), which is higher than the Indiana state average of 38% (majority Hispanic and Black).
